...The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in Missouri... Blackwater River near Blue Lick affecting Cooper and Saline Counties. Wakenda Creek at Carrollton affecting Carroll County. ...The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Kansas... Marais Des Cygnes River at Osawatomie affecting Miami County. * WHAT...Minor flooding is forecast. * WHERE...Blackwater River near Blue Lick. * WHEN...From this evening to Saturday afternoon. * IMPACTS...At 24.0 feet, Cropland and pastures along the river flood. At 29.0 feet, Livestock in pastures along the river may be endangered. Extensive damage also occurs to cropland and pasture.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 1:45 PM CDT Wednesday the stage was 20.0 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to rise above flood stage this evening to a crest of 27.1 feet tomorrow evening. It will then fall below flood stage Friday afternoon. - Flood stage is 24.0 feet.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
